信息工程转CS.编程方面的学习计划

做项目做项目做项目。写辣鸡代码写辣鸡代码。
■网友
同信工,大二的时候确信自己更喜欢CS而不是EE所以开始换方向学习,当然并没有转专业,学习方法因人而异所以没办法提供具体的可参考的内容,不过倒是可以以一个通信狗转行搞IT的过来人的身份提供一些建议给题主(ps:答主也是个弱渣,不过总归是用血泪换来的经验):1.信工专业课程与计算机软件专业的课程内容出入很大,如果题主真想往软开的方向发展,计算机的基本功请一定要打好,数据结构与算法这些自不用说,计算机网络、操作系统等也要好好看下,具体可参考你们学校软院计院的课程安排,当然谷歌一下也有一堆啦2.语言学习方面,学习资源谷歌一查一大把,像题主说喜欢Java,刚开始基本语法,深一点继承多态OOP容器,再深一点线程并发GC,^_^虚拟机,当然这只是个大概的层次顺序,题主可自行根据兴趣需要随意穿叉学习3.积极主动的找些项目做,小到自己网上找些感兴趣的小应用做下,大到老师实验室或者找外包,总之,总还是需要一两个拿得出手的项目伴身的4.最后一个,也是被很多人说烂的一个,打代码打代码打代码(重要三遍) 看再多的书都不如亲手敲多几行代码来得实在以上。


    推荐阅读